Written by: Gretchen Benner As this year winds down and PMT prepares for 2025, I am amazed to reflect upon the accomplishments and growth achieved this year. As a new nonprofit organization, themes of perseverance and commitment resonate. Piedmont Music Therapy (PMT) was awarded its first grants this year which assisted to provide programming to new community members, and provide modern equipment for staff, students and volunteers to access technology while maintaining confidentiality. The network developed through York County Chamber of Commerce’s Nonprofit Leadership Certification Program has been wonderful support with mentorship in my new role as Executive Director. Reflecting on this infographic with metrics on individual music therapy clients, music students and groups provided throughout Mecklenburg and York Counties, causes much amazement. The clinical team has a strong reputation of providing high quality, person centered services while delivering appointments that uphold health and safety standards in the Carolinas. With 2025 approaching, I look forward to PMT continuing to connect, play and grow with clientele with diverse diagnoses, conditions and backgrounds, yet meaningful connection through the arts.
